Magic Tomato Salad: The Explosion of Flavor in Your Mouth

Ingredients:

  • 4-5 ripe heirloom tomatoes (mixed colors for visual pop), chopped
  • 1 pint c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1 small red onion, very thinly sliced
  • 1 cucumber, diced
  • 1 avocado, diced (optional but amazing)
  • 1 handful fresh basil leaves, torn
  • 1 handful fresh mint leaves, finely chopped
  • ½ tsp chili flakes or fresh chopped red chili (adjust to taste)
  • 1 tbsp capers or chopped olives
  • ½ tsp flaky sea salt
  • Freshly ground black pepper, to taste

🧪 Magic Flavor Bomb Dressing:

  • 3 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
  • 1 tbsp balsamic glaze (or 1½ tbsp aged balsamic vinegar)
  • 1 tsp Dijon mustard
  • ½ lemon, juiced (or use lime for a twist)
  • 1 clove garlic, finely minced
  • 1 tsp honey or maple syrup
  • Zest of ½ lemon

💥 Optional Additions (for extra explosion):

  • Crumbled feta or goat cheese
  • Toasted pine nuts or pistachios
  • A few thin slices of fresh peach or nectarine
  • A drizzle of pomegranate molasses

🛠️ Instructions:

  1. Prep the produce: Wash and chop all vegetables. Layer the tomatoes, onion, cucumber, and avocado in a large bowl. Add the herbs on top.
  2. Mix the dressing: In a jar or small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, balsamic glaze, mustard, lemon juice, garlic, honey, and zest until emulsified.
  3. Assemble the salad: Pour the dressing over the veggies. Toss gently to coat. Let sit for 5–10 minutes so the flavors start to meld.
  4. Flavor boost: Sprinkle with chili flakes, sea salt, black pepper, and any optional toppings. Taste and adjust seasoning.
  5. Serve: Best served slightly chilled or at room temperature with crusty bread or as a side to grilled meat, tofu, or seafood.

🎉 Why It’s “Magic”:

  • The acidity of the lemon and balsamic wakes up your palate.
  • The herbs and garlic add complexity and punch.
  • The tomatoes burst with juicy freshness.
  • And every bite offers contrast — soft, crunchy, sweet, spicy, creamy, and tangy.
